Maduro and his wife have been accused of being top-level members of a drug group called “Cartel De Los Soles”. “Cartel De Los Soles” is a network of high-ranking Venezuelan military officials allegedly involved in drug trafficking and corruption. Maduro is also accused of a conspiracy to commit narcoterrorism, to import cocaine and possessing machineguns and destructive devices. Trump has claimed that Venezuela under Maduro hosted foreign adversaries in the U.S region and has offensive weapons that could be a threat to U.S interest and lives of its citizens.
The hundreds of thousands of Venezuelan migrants in America have been blamed on Maduro as well. Trump who is focused on fighting the flow of drugs mostly fentanyl and cocaine into the U.S has been accused by Maduro that his war on drugs is a way to defend his reasoning on trying to remove Maduro from office and get America’s hands on Venezuela’s immense oil reserves. Chinese Foreign Minister Wang Yi has spoken about Trumps operation saying that the U.S is acting like a world judge. He also says that the authority and security of all countries should be protected fully under international law. China’s Foreign Ministry spokesperson Lin Jian said that China still was maintaining positive communication with the Venezuelan government. Russia’s Foreign Ministry has expressed that Maduro’s capture was an unacceptable invasion on the sovereignty of an independent state. Brazil, Chile, Colombia, Mexico and Uruguay have communicated their deep concern and nonacceptance of the military action carried out unilaterally in Venezuela which violates fundamental principles of international law. Even though some international leaders don’t agree with Trump’s decision, close ally to Trump, Argentinian President Javier Milei has expressed his beliefs of long live freedom and how freedom moves forward. Benjamin Netanyahu, Israel’s Prime Minster congratulated Trump for his bold and historic leadership on behalf of justice and freedom.
